Sperm selection for intrauterine insemination

InfertilityFertility Disorders

Part of Women’s health & pregnancy clinical trials.

This trial tests a device called ZyMōt Multi that selects the best sperm for intrauterine insemination (IUI). It may help couples trying to conceive by improving the chance of a live birth.

Who can take part

  • You are using fresh sperm from your partner (not frozen or donor).
  • Female partner is under 37 years old at the first insemination.
  • This is your first IUI attempt, and you can have up to 3 attempts within 6 months.
  • Female BMI is less than 35.
  • You have regular periods (every 26 to 35 days).
  • At least one fallopian tube is open (checked by a special test called Hyfosy).
